## Foraging
{For the enthusiastic, wild mushroom foraging in the UK can be a possibility. But be aware of the important legal and safety rules.
- **Legal Considerations**: {It is typically legal to pick fungi from the wild for your own consumption on most public land. {However, it is an offence to dig up or remove plants without the landowner's consent on land you do not own. Commercial foraging is strictly prohibited on Forestry England land.
- **Safety**: {Never consume a wild plant or fungus unless you are 100% sure of its identification. {Some fungi are highly toxic. It is advisable to go with an expert if you are a beginner.
## Legal and Safety Considerations
When buying mushrooms in the UK, it's important to be aware of the legal framework.
- **Gourmet & Culinary Mushrooms**: Buying and consuming common edible mushrooms like oyster, shiitake, and button mushrooms is completely legal in the UK.
- **Magic Mushrooms**: {Psilocybin mushrooms (magic mushrooms) are classified as a Class A drug in the UK. {Possession, cultivation, and distribution are illegal. {While spores may be legal to buy in some jurisdictions, growing them is strictly prohibited in the UK.
